Firstly, let’s talk hair. The smoothed low bun is as chic as up-do’s come. Topknots are still awesome, but a bit 2010. It’s time to move forward, and the new bun height to love is at the nape of the neck. Plus, this style allows your face to become the focus, like a blank canvas with no eye-catching frame taking away from your sparkly eyes and pretty pout.
Hint: to ensure your strands stay smooth, be sure to apply some Pureology Super Smooth Smoothing Cream onto damp hair to eliminate frizz, and spritz some Paul Mitchell Spray Wax on your finished look to ensure the ‘do stays put.
Next – the face. What a pretty colour palette! That pink hue on the lips is to die for, the light natural blush complements the bright pink lip pigment well, and the subtle-looking eye and brow finishes off the whole look perfectly.
To achieve this perfect summer party face for yourself, invest in a great stay-put lippy like Estée Lauder Pure Colour Long Lasting Lipstick in Nectarine; a light pink illuminating blush like ARTISTRY Powder Blush in Blushing Bride; and some natural-coloured eye and brow products to tie it all together (glominerals gloPrecision brow pencil, and Revlon Beyond Natural Defining Mascara in Black Brown are perfect!)
This look would be great sported at a summer garden party, or for an evening of poolside cocktails.
